#6d3d1d basic color information

#6d3d1d

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#6d3d1d has decimal index of: 7159069, is composed of 42.7% red, 23.9% green and 11.4% blue. #6d3d1d in CMYK color model, is composed of 0% cyan, 44% magenta, 73.4% yellow and 57.3% black.
#663333 is the closest web-safe color to #6d3d1d.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.
